Yerevan already responded to Moscow - Armenia parliament speaker

Armenia has responded to the Russian Federation Council letter, which reflected on the anti-Russian statements by National Assembly (NA) speaker Alen Simonyan. Simonyan himself told this to reporters at the NA Monday, APA reports citing news.am.

"The letter was sent to Sargis Khandanyan (i.e. Chair of the NA Standing Committee on Foreign Relations). And Sargis Khandanyan replied to that letter a long time ago—after a day or two. It's just that at that moment it was convenient for Mrs. Maria Zakharova (the spokesperson of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s) to react like that and not to react to the other part. It's clear, isn't it, that a staged question-and-answer session is taking place," said Simonyan.

Simonyan added that he knows what the Russian side responded, but did not elaborate: "I know, but I won't tell. It does not concern me. I am the owner of my statements. What I said, I said correctly, I said appropriately, I did not say anything new. I am ready to repeat the same things today and always."
